Minister Ivaylo Moskovski presented in Qatar the opportunities for concession of transport sites 18.05.2015

The Minister of Transport, Information Technology and Communications Ivaylo Moskovski took part in the delegation accompanying Prime Minister Boyko Borisov during his official visit to the State of Qatar on 16-18 May 2015.

During the visit Minister Ivaylo Moskovski held bilateral meetings with the Minister of Information and Communication Technologies Hessa ​​Al Jaber and the Minister of Transport Jassem Bin Saif Ahmed Al Sulaiti.

In the transport field Minister Ivaylo Moskovski presented the transport infrastructure sites ready for concession and drew particular attention to the opportunities offered by the Bulgarian airports and ports. The Qatari side expressed interest in the port of Varna, and the two sides agreed on Qatari professionals to visit the port and to get acquainted with the opportunities it offers. The Qatar side proposed the signing of a Memorandum for development of maritime transport between the two countries during the visit.

During the talks the Qatari side confirmed the interest in exploiting the airline Doha - Varna by Qatar Airways. The possibility for training and exchange of experience in the field of airspace management was also discussed.

In the field of information technology the two sides discussed strengthening the cooperation by organizing visits and a business forum in Qatar, which will present the experience of Bulgarian ICT companies and the development of future projects between the two countries in this field.
